DRX9000 for L5 Lumbar Disc Herniations

San Francisco Spinal Decompression Doctor Comments:

Axiom_marketing_dvd_109_2The most common lumbar disc to herniate is the L5-S1 disc. The L5-S1 spinal disc is the disc in between your 5th lumbar vertebrae and the sacrum...your tail bone.

The L5-S1 lumbar disc absorbs more load than the other lumbar discs (L1-L4) and therefore is more prone to injury.

Most of the patients that we treat at Executive Express Chiropractic in downtown San Francisco have a primary disc herniation at L5-S1. Our method of treatment is the DRX9000 lumbar spinal decompression machine, made by Axiom Worldwide.

Not everyone that has a herniated lumbar disc needs spinal decompression...only those that do not respond to conventional chiropractic care, physical therapy, or other conservative treatments. I usually give chiropractic a fair chance to deliver results...but if chiropractic fails to achieve a favorable outcome, we consider lumbar decompression with the DRX9000.

Md_news_photos_011If the herniated disc is at L5...we set the machine to target the L5-S1 disc level. The DRX9000 is able to actually isolate on a specific spinal disc...unlike regular traction which pulls everything.

How hard we pull is determined by your body weight, your overall physical condition, and whether or not you are in acute pain or not. Typically, we start off very easy and work our way up. Usually patients enjoy the DRX sessions...some even fall asleep. My patients tell me it sure beats cortisone injections.
